Eckes, Suzanne E.; Plucker, Jonathan A. – Center for Evaluation and Education Policy, Indiana University, 2004
Charter schools are given greater autonomy than traditional public schools, and in return they are held more accountable to the public. As such, if a charter school fails to meet its educational objectives, the charter may be revoked or not renewed.
